I have a Bush Hog SQ 160 that I purchased, used, a few years ago. The area that I intended to use it in (or on) proved to be too wet for my son's Kubota L 3800. I got stuck a couple times and decided to go with a DR walk behind cutter. So the Bush Hog has been sitting a couple years. I have an opportunity to sell it now, so I went to hook it up to make sure it still operates well. And that's where I ran into a problem. It seems after sitting for a couple years, the 2 parts of the PTO Shaft, where one slides inside the other, have apparently corroded and locked together to a point where I can't separate them. I have sprayed a "creeping" compound at that joint for several days in a row, and I have tried driving the outer part off with a brass drift. It doesn't want to budge. I don't have much experience with PTO shafts, so I don't know if this is common? Any help or suggestions would be greatly appreciated. Thanks

Can you disconnect PTO shaft at the Bush Hog end?
....then try the wish-bone method. Chain one end to a tree (one of them-there Rutvegas maples I presume), the other to the L3800, then make a wish....and pull.

Don't pull on it hard with it still attached to Bush Hog or you may wreck gear box's input bearing.

Might take a little heat in combination with penetrating oil or diesel fuel to help it release. Propane torch or better yet map gas...just heat one side of the union so it expands faster. Then a good jerk works better than a come a long. Mine did that years ago and now every time I park it for the season it gets lubed up and wrapped in saran wrap.
